And here she is:

LBK (Little Big Knife)- combat model.

5160 steel, full quench and variable temper. 4.5 inch edge, 4.5 inch blade length, 9.5 inches overall.

Grind is a full convex with distal taper from the hilt forward. Convex microbevel edge. Tang thickness is .20 inches. .160 about 2/3 of the way forward.

Handle is black linen micarta with blue spacers, stainless tubing pins flared at the ends.

Sheath by Koyote Girl. It's the expedition style sheath with a tight fitting retaining strap. the rear belt hange is removable for horizontal carry. I fitted it to a regular heavy 1.5 inch leather belt- it's tight but will break in. (The belt hanger is secured with chicago screws and highly adjustable.)
